Revisiting the public awareness of aphasia in Exeter: 16 years on.

Abstract

: Surveys of awareness of aphasia have been conducted worldwide. There has been no survey of change in awareness in one place over time. A survey in Exeter, UK in 2001 found awareness of aphasia was strikingly low. The aim of this study was to conduct a repeat survey using the same methods in the same city 16 years later to examine changes in awareness and knowledge. : We surveyed 167 shoppers in Exeter examining awareness and knowledge of aphasia. Awareness of stroke, stuttering, dyslexia and autism were examined for comparison. Demographic information was collected. : Thirty-four percent had heard of aphasia and 5% had some basic knowledge. Awareness of aphasia had improved significantly from 2001 to 2017, but basic knowledge had not. Awareness was higher in professional groups, such as lawyers and academics, and healthcare workers and in those who knew someone with aphasia. Awareness, but not knowledge, was higher in older respondents. Awareness of aphasia was significantly lower than awareness of all other conditions. : We found a significant increase in awareness of aphasia in Exeter since 2001, but not knowledge. The implications of ongoing low levels of aphasia awareness, like inadequate funding and difficulty integrating into an ill-informed society, are discussed.

摘要

全球范围内都开展了关于失语症认知情况的调查。但还没有针对某一地区随时间推移认知变化的调查。2001年在英国埃克塞特进行的一项调查发现,人们对失语症的认知程度极低。本研究的目的是16年后在同一城市采用相同方法进行重复调查,以考察认知和知识的变化情况。

我们对埃克塞特的167名购物者进行了调查,考察他们对失语症的认知和了解情况。同时还调查了他们对中风、口吃、诵读困难和自闭症的认知情况以作比较。收集了人口统计学信息。

34%的人听说过失语症,5%的人有一些基本知识。从2001年到2017年,人们对失语症的认知有了显著提高,但基本知识方面没有变化。专业群体(如律师、学者)、医护人员以及认识失语症患者的人对失语症的认知程度更高。年龄较大的受访者认知程度更高,但在知识方面并非如此。对失语症的认知明显低于对所有其他病症的认知。

我们发现,自2001年以来,埃克塞特对失语症的认知有了显著提高,但知识方面没有。本文讨论了失语症认知水平持续较低所带来的影响,如资金不足以及融入信息匮乏社会的困难等问题。
